Once I choose a trip, whether I am creating my own itinerary, joining a tour, or booking a small ship cruise, I start doing my homework. To me, it's a big part of the fun.
I research the places I'll be visiting, including sights to see and events to attend. If it's my own trip, I book tickets online well in advance so I don't miss something I want to see or do, or waste time waiting in line. And I try to find a good book to read in advance about the area's history, culture, and cuisine.
As I travel, I take photos. I've taken some incredible shots through car and bus windows. Around corners most people don't bother with. I love to get up close to my subjects to capture the beautiful details. Frequently, I hang back and let the crowd pass in order to capture the place without people. And I always look up, too, because amazing sights are everywhere!
Later, I organize 25 of the most interesting shots into a photo album and add comments, often researching a sight to learn more or verify facts. Each of my albums is carefully curated to honor the beauty and history of earth's myriad stunning places. I hope you'll enjoy them all!
